I agree that the situation in India is dreadful, despite it being a major producer of vaccines. I note the Indian Gov has ordered social media not to refer to the 'Indian variant'.  

"India's government has instructed social media companies to remove any content that refers to the "Indian variant" of Covid-19.

The IT ministry said the World Health Organization (WHO) listed the variant as B.1.617 and any reference to "Indian" was false."

The 'war' between India and Pakistan has been stop/start since the two countries became independent. 1947, 1965, 1971 and 1999. 

Border skirmishes are much more common and there have been several since 2000. 

There's also the insurgency in Jammu and Kashmir that the Indians blame on Pakistan and the insurgency in Balochistan that Pakistan blames on India.

If there is a war, then the danger is that China will get involved on the side of Pakistan. They have their own border skirmishes with India. (The latest last year.)
